The Valbona to Theth hike (or its reverse, Theth to Valbona) is Albania's signature mountain trek. The 17-kilometre trail crosses the Valbona Pass at 1,795 metres, taking most hikers 6–8 hours through exposed alpine terrain, loose scree, and sections with no mobile signal.

It is beautiful. It is demanding. And it is exactly the kind of trek where the wrong insurance — or no insurance at all — leaves you dangerously exposed.

The Route and Its Risks

Altitude Profile

  • Start (Valbona): ~1,000m
  • Valbona Pass (summit): 1,795m
  • End (Theth): ~800m

The pass section — roughly 4 kilometres on each side of the summit — is the most dangerous part. The terrain includes:

  • Loose scree and gravel on the north-facing descent into Theth (extremely slippery when wet)
  • Exposed ridgeline with no shelter from lightning storms
  • Snowfields that can persist into late June and return in early September
  • Steep drop-offs with no barriers or railings

Common Injuries

Based on incidents reported by local guesthouse owners and mountain guides:

  1. Twisted/sprained ankles — the single most common injury, usually on the Theth-side descent
  2. Knee injuries — from the steep 1,000m descent
  3. Heat exhaustion — the exposed summit section has no shade from 10am–4pm
  4. Hypothermia — sudden weather changes can drop temperatures 15°C in 30 minutes
  5. Falls — loose rock and wet conditions cause slips with potential fracture injuries

Rescue Access

  • No vehicle access to the pass or either approach trail
  • No mobile signal from approximately 1,300m on the Valbona side to 1,200m on the Theth side
  • Rescue by mule is the standard ground evacuation method
  • Helicopter access depends on weather and is dispatched from Tirana (~40 minutes flight time)

Preparation Checklist

Beyond insurance, here is what you should prepare for the crossing:

  • Rent trekking poles — essential for the steep descent
  • Store your luggage in Shkodër before the hike — you cannot carry suitcases over the pass
  • Carry 2+ litres of water — there is limited water on the pass section
  • Start early (before 8am) to avoid afternoon storms
  • Download offline maps with the trail marked
